Expansion Joint

A separation between different sections of a structure (usually concrete) to allow for relative movement between the sections without damaging the structure. The gap may be filled with an elastic material like silicone to provide a watertight structure.

Attributes

An attribute is a particular piece of data that describes a property of an object. Each Element Type is described by a different set of attributes, although there are some attributes that are common to many Element Types.
